How Do I File an Estate Claim in a Florida Probate?

If you are owed money from a person in Florida who is now deceased, you may want to talk to a Florida probate attorney about how you get paid?  Why? Well, you are a creditor to the Florida probate.  That means that you may have only between 30 days to 2  years to file your claim depending on any number of circumstances.  But don’t wait.
